The price of Bitcoin is steady at around $30,600, reflecting a nearly 0.50% increase on Wednesday.
The consumer price index saw a 0.2% rise in June, marking a 3% increase from a year ago, the lowest level since March 2021.
With the release of US core inflation data, investors are evaluating the potential impact on Bitcoin's price. The question arises: is it the right time to buy?
